Great Highway Reversal Measure Qualifies for San Francisco’s November 3 Ballot
The San Francisco Department of Elections certified enough signatures to put a measure reopening the Great Highway to weekday cars on the November 3, 2026 ballot.

San Francisco’s Board of Supervisors voted 9-2 to put a public bank measure on the November 3, 2026 ballot. If it passes, the city would be the first in the US with its own bank.
